Some states offer a shortened, or abstract, version of official evidences of birth, but this version might not be acceptable proof when applying for a job, a passport, etc.
The certified copies of official proofs of birth will have the date the certificate was filed with the registrar's office; the registrar's raised, embossed or multicolored seal, and the registrar's signature.
